71. WHICH IS MIDDLE PRAYER?
In this Quranic verse 2:238 it has been said 'Guard the middle prayer' Prophet Muhammad (pbuh) had interpreted that –middle prayer is referring to only 'Asr' prayer
(Refer Bukhari 6396. )
We should not consider the views of others regarding the middle prayer after Prophet Muhammad (pbuh) had given elucidation
This verse reveals another matter.
We know that Muslims must pray five times a day and that there are many evidence for this in Hadith. Nevertheless it has not been said in Quran as five times prayer. Hence, certain people assume that 'five times prayer' is against Quran.
Eventhough this verse did not say plainly that there are five times prayers; it indirectly says that there exist prayers at least five times a day.
This verses command us to establish prayers and middle prayer.
'Prayers' is plural. Since there is a distinct word ‘dual’ in Arabic to mention a pair (two). Plural in Arabic only would mean three at least. There is no plural in Arabic which would refer to less than three. (In Arabic plural would not mean two and above but it would mean three and above)
If it is said 'Establish prayers (minimum three) especially the middle prayer” totally it becomes four prayers. If it should be said 'middle' then it must be an odd number. There could not be' middle' in four.
There could be middle only if the numeral was five.
Hence we can understand from this that the total number of prayers is only five per day.
Some people might assume that even if the numeral (number of prayers) was three, there would be a middle one. Of course it is true there can be middle if the numeral is three.
But since the plural form ‘prayers’ has been used and also there is a mention about middle prayer distinctly, total would become four (three prayer + middle prayer).
We should look at the word ‘plural’ and at the same time we should regard the word ‘middle’ also. So if we consider both these (plural and middle prayer) we can understand that there remain five time prayers.
(For more details 226th and 361st explanatory notes and Quran, 30:17, 18)
